2026 Bajaj Avenger Launched: Affordable Cruiser Bike with Classic Style, Better Comfort, and Strong Value

2026 Bajaj Avenger

The 2026 Bajaj Avenger has been officially launched, bringing a refreshed version of one of India’s most recognizable cruiser motorcycles. Known for its relaxed riding posture, low seat height, and comfortable road manners, the Avenger continues to target riders who prefer calm, stress-free motorcycling over aggressive performance. With subtle updates, improved refinement, and a price that remains within reach of everyday buyers, the new model reinforces its reputation as a practical cruiser for Indian roads.

Classic Cruiser Design with a Familiar Road Presence

The design of the 2026 Bajaj Avenger stays true to its cruiser identity. The low-slung stance, long wheelbase, and wide handlebars instantly communicate a laid-back riding character. Bajaj has avoided drastic styling changes, choosing instead to refine the existing design with subtle enhancements that keep the motorcycle visually relevant.

The fuel tank maintains its muscular yet elegant shape, complemented by updated paint schemes and refined graphics. The round headlamp continues to define the Avenger’s classic appeal, while improved lighting elements help enhance visibility during night rides. Chrome accents are applied tastefully, adding a premium touch without overpowering the overall design.

Engine Performance Tuned for Smooth and Relaxed Riding

The 2026 Bajaj Avenger is powered by a refined engine setup focused on smoothness and everyday usability. Rather than chasing high top speeds, the engine delivers steady and predictable power, which suits city commuting as well as relaxed highway cruising.

Low and mid-range torque delivery makes the bike easy to ride in traffic, reducing the need for frequent gear changes. Bajaj has also worked on improving engine refinement, resulting in lower vibrations and a more polished riding feel. Throttle response feels controlled and rider-friendly, which is especially beneficial for beginners and daily commuters.

Comfort-Focused Ride Quality and Suspension Setup

Comfort remains the strongest highlight of the 2026 Avenger. The low seat height makes it approachable for riders of varying heights, while the wide, well-cushioned seat provides excellent support during long rides. The relaxed riding posture, combined with forward-set footpegs and upright handlebars, helps reduce fatigue over extended distances.

The suspension is tuned to handle rough patches, speed breakers, and uneven roads effectively. Whether navigating city streets or cruising on highways, the Avenger maintains a stable and planted feel. Pillion comfort has also been considered, with a supportive rear seat that allows longer two-up rides without discomfort.

Improved Braking and Safety Confidence

Safety has received meaningful attention in the 2026 Bajaj Avenger. The braking system delivers better control and predictability, especially during sudden stops or challenging traffic situations. Disc brakes at both ends, supported by modern braking assistance, enhance rider confidence.

The bike remains stable under braking, an important factor for cruiser-style motorcycles with longer wheelbases. These improvements make the Avenger better suited for real-world riding conditions, including wet roads and busy urban environments.
